Transaction 6e4bb399fdd8ae5a37addbd3f503a3c180e9db96f3ed86d1f9a0bc19e70217cc
1 Input
1 Output
-
6e4bb399fdd8ae5a37addbd3f503a3c180e9db96f3ed86d1f9a0bc19e70217cc:0
- value
- 70962
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dd63ec0243fe3d4419252110ad8877efe2a4931b OP_EQUAL
- address
- 3MscxdjvnXBC18iEdtyurhkhdtMbHzdRXv